Laide Bakare clears air after backlash over taking daughter to club at 17

Nollywood actress Laide Bakare has responded to the heavy criticism she received following her controversial statement about taking her daughter, Similoluwa, to a nightclub at the age of 17.

In a recent conversation with content creator Mr Lil Gaga, Bakare revealed that she was the one who gave her daughter her first club experience and even let her taste alcohol, explaining that it was part of preparing her for adulthood.

The statement quickly stirred online outrage, with many Nigerians accusing the actress of being irresponsible and fueling stereotypes that “single mothers can’t raise children properly.”

Reacting to the backlash, Bakare took to Instagram to clarify her comments, insisting that her words had been misunderstood. She shared a video from her daughter’s birthday afterparty, explaining that she never said she introduced her to alcohol.

“Let me mention clearly here that I never said I introduced my daughter, @simlineboss, to alcohol. I only stated that she entered a club with me for the very first time in her life at her birthday afterparty. How is that bad naw?” she wrote.

In another post, she added, “No please, I didn’t do alcohol with @simlineboss, only club, and it’s just to give her a bit of exposure towards the future. I’m not as bad as you think.”

Despite her clarification, the debate continues online, with fans divided over whether her parenting style was protective or inappropriate.
